TsunamiReady
- voluntary, community-based program. Communities must:
Establish a 24-hour warning point.
Develop multiple ways to receive tsunami warnings and alert the public
Develop a formal tsunami hazard plan and conduct emergency exercises.
Promote public readiness through community education.
